ServiceNow, Inc. (NYSE:NOW) Shares Sold by Main Street Research LLC

ServiceNow logo with Computer and Technology background

Main Street Research LLC decreased its position in shares of ServiceNow, Inc. (NYSE:NOW - Free Report) by 48.1% during the first qu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 16,997 shares of the information technology services provider's stock after selling 15,740 shares during the quarter. Main Street Research LLC's holdings in ServiceNow were worth $13,532,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

ServiceNow Price Performance

Shares of NYSE:NOW traded down $11.65 during trading on Friday, reaching $956.44. The stock had a trading volume of 280,600 shares, compared to its average volume of 1,475,740.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.15, a quick ratio of 1.12 and a current ratio of 1.12. The business has a fifty day moving average price of $1,008.88 and a 200-day moving average price of $961.75. The stock has a market cap of $197.97 billion, a PE ratio of 130.29, a PEG ratio of 4.66 and a beta of 0.94. ServiceNow, Inc. has a 1-year low of $678.66 and a 1-year high of $1,198.09.

ServiceNow (NYSE:NOW -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 23rd. The information technology services provider reported $4.04 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$3.78 by $0.26. The firm had revenue of $3.09 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$3.09 billion. ServiceNow had a return on equity of 17.34% and a net margin of 13.41%. The business's revenue was up 18.6%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the company posted $3.41 earnings per share. On average, equities analysts forecast that ServiceNow, Inc. will post 8.93 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About ServiceNow

(Free Report)

ServiceNow, Inc provides end to-end intelligent workflow automation platform solutions for digital businesses in the North America, Europe, the Middle East and Africa, Asia Pacific, and internationally. The company operates the Now platform for end-to-end digital transformation, artificial intelligence, machine learning, robotic process automation, process mining, performance analytics, and collaboration and development tools.
